About this book

The Dark Wolf God was nothing more than a bedtime story used to frighten young shifters, until he tore into reality and shattered everything Samantha knew. After a brutal attack that left her pack in ruins, she finds herself ripped from her world and held captive by the very monster she was taught to fear. Cadean is a shifter of terrifying legend, a lethal alpha burdened by a dark curse and an ancient war with the fae. He believes Samantha is the key to his salvation, and he will stop at nothing to unlock the mysterious magic hidden within her.

This gripping paranormal romance masterfully blends high-stakes pack dynamics with a volatile enemies-to-lovers tension. As the slow-burn attraction between captive and captor intensifies, Samantha must navigate the thin line between survival and surrender. Is Cadean merely a monster consumed by his own dark soul, or is there a man worth redeeming buried beneath his savage exterior?
